WebRed wolves inhabit upland and bottomland forests, coastal prairies, swamps and marshes. These animals require dense vegetation to protect denning sites and resting areas. Web20. mar 2024 · The Northern Rocky Mountain Population includes wolves who live in Yellowstone, the northern Rockies, Idaho, and Wyoming. There are currently about 1,650 wolves in this population region. ... The red wolf is one of the world’s most endangered canids. By the 1960s, only a few red wolves remained in Louisiana and North Carolina. In …

Other English names for the species include Asian wild dog, Asiatic wild dog, [2] Indian wild dog, [3] whistling dog, red dog, [4] red wolf, [5] and mountain wolf.
